Premium stereo optics from ZEISS
Zoom knob to enlarge, zoom ratio 5:1, magnification 0.8x ~ 4x, complete with freeze-frame design.
Suitable for laboratories, biology classrooms, industrial production lines and other occasions. Using Greenough optical design, the image at the same position is imaged to both eyes through two optical paths, creating a three-dimensional feeling that still looks like direct vision after magnification.
Integrate a variety of lighting to suit various tasks
It has vertical downlight, lateral oblique light and transmitted bottom light. Multiple lighting options, corresponding to different observation situations. Observing the image patterns of samples under different light sources is also very suitable for observing the reflection of crystals from light sources at different angles. There is an adjustment button on the right side of the microscope holder, which can be clicked and rotated to adjust and switch the light source in a unified manner, making the operation smooth and intuitive.
Unique vertical epi-illumination
The ZEISS STEMI 305 observation head has a built-in vertical incident light source and is uniquely designed to effectively illuminate targets with deep holes and observe the reflection pattern of light sources on the surface of the object being measured.
Multifunctional oblique lighting
The bracket of the EDU series models is equipped with a lateral oblique light source that can be raised, lowered, adjusted in angle and focused. Manually adjust the height and angle of the light source directly along the track, and move the lamp head back and forth to focus the light source.Transillumination with easy switching between bright and dark fields of view
The stage is equipped with a penetrating light source, and the light and dark field of view can be instantly changed through the lever on the right side. There is no need to move the observation object or disassemble the stage, and the operation is smooth.
A variety of lighting systems are available as optional extras
Compatible with various types of ring lights, snake neck lights, cold fiber optic conduit lighting... freely selectable according to usage needs.

Product specifications
Microscope body | |
form | Greenough design, binocular stereo microscope |
Visual tilt angle | The observation tube is tilted 45 degrees, and the distance between the eyes can be adjusted from 55-75mm. |
Zoom ratio | Zoom ratio 5:1, without auxiliary lens and 10x eyepiece, the standard total magnification range is 8x to 40x (inclusive) |
Objective lens magnification | 0.8x, 1x, 2x, 3x, 4x (with freeze-frame positioning assistance) |
working distance | 110mm or more (without auxiliary mirror) |
Eyepiece form | Binocular type, a pair of 10x eyepieces, super wide field of view 23mm, the diopter of both eyes can be adjusted independently on the eyepieces |
Vertical down-light LED light | There is a built-in vertical down-emission LED light source at the objective lens end, and the power supply can be directly connected to the original base for dimming, so that fine reflective surfaces can be observed. |
EDU focusing base | |
light source | LED upper and lower independent light sources, built-in upper and lower light source dimmers, are installed on the side of the square column below the focus lifter. The dimmer can be used as a power switch, and can also adjust the brightness of the upper, lower, or both upper and lower light sources. |
Light source adjustment | The side reflection light source is equipped with a single projection as standard or an optional double coil tube. The lamp holder is fixed in front of the machine column and can slide up and down with a slide rail, and the light guide angle can be adjusted. |
Light source standard | Standard single-tube side projection light source, adjustable focusing or astigmatism |
LED color temperature | At least 5600K, lifespan is at least 25,000 hours, and brightness will not decay |
Countertop size | D310mm x W200mm x H35mm |
work surface | D195mm x W160mm |
Filter or polarizer | The base can place a 45mm filter or polarizer (optional) |
penetrating light | Switchable between bright field and dark field functions (standard configuration) |
power supply | Integrated upper and lower light source power supplies, eliminating the need for external power supplies |
